Notes From Your Bookseller

Part memoir, part cultural commentary, Hillbilly Elegy pulls from Vance's rural upbringing and examines the white working class in Appalachia, along with their gradual descent into discontent.

From a former marine and Yale Law School graduate, a powerful account of growing up in a poor Rust Belt town that offers a broader, probing look at the struggles of America’s white working class

Hillbilly Elegy is a passionate and personal analysis of a culture in crisis—that of white working-class Americans.
